They shall be -z, the expanded worth of the variable (even if it’s an empty string) and ]. When the muse condition testing of the test could also be merely transmitted to test designwork objects, a low degree of element of check conditions is employed. Below, you’ll find an instance of two check cases verifying the functionality of sending messages in an online messenger.
The Necessities Of Software Program Testing: Why It Issues
In common the ultimate result would rely upon the variable content material and the implementation of [. The solely distinction is take a look at trello doesn’t require ].[ -n whatever ] is equal to check -n no matter. This means [ -n whatever ] is only a [ command with few arguments.
Including An Api Step To Your Check
Passes if any embedded situation is true.This allows you to combine several AND and OR conditions collectively. Example for Step 2 − Inputs and information consists of person credentials along with legitimate fee transaction data. Example for Step 1 − Payment can be processed only with right consumer and fee transaction particulars. The key elements of a check case embody the take a look at case ID, check description, stipulations, take a look at steps, check data, anticipated results, precise outcomes, and post-conditions. To guarantee check instances cover all necessities, we use a necessities traceability matrix (RTM) . This helps map take a look at cases to particular necessities, ensuring that all requirements are examined and validated.
Advantages Of Describing Check Circumstances In A Detailed Method
The first case has larger precedence, as sending textual content messages is a elementary want for end-users wanting to make use of the messenger. Inserting emoticons is a further “gimmick”, so it might be checked later. Each take a look at state of affairs ought to consist of test situation identification, an inventory of preparatory actions, take a look at circumstances, and last actions. By contrast, anyone should be succesful of hint the check situations ahead to check designs and different take a look at work merchandise as soon as they’re created. Then from this, there is a main Test Condition of ‘Create Note’ and further Test Conditions of Add, Edit, Save, Delete and Close then from these circumstances you’d write check cases that examine this functionality. In the picture beneath, the requirements define what the ‘Functionality’ circle is.
Examine For Situation And Exit For Any Check Execution
Let us take the instance of a take a look at condition for payment performance. The check situations built using automation are extra detailed they usually can be used to create extra granular and robust test instances. The check conditions are well documented and contain minute details. The areas of the software program which usually tend to be uncovered to dangers, have more take a look at circumstances to mitigate them, somewhat than less risk susceptible areas. Here it’s being checked in by clicking on the login button if the web page is loaded and the ‘ Welcome to login page ‘ message is displayed.
If take a look at situations are described in great depth, big number of take a look at situations will be created. Let us take the instance of testing the checkout means of an e-commerce application. Test analysis of a specified testing level can be done only after the check circumstances for the level have been defined. The sun elevation can be used to test if the sun has set or risen, it’s dusk, it’s evening, etc. when a trigger occurs.For an in-depth rationalization of solar elevation, see solar elevation trigger.
- A check case is an outlined format for software program testing required to examine if a specific application/software is working or not.
- Here it’s being checked in by clicking on the login button if the page is loaded and the ‘ Welcome to login page ‘ message is displayed.
- Passes if any embedded condition is true.This allows you to combine several AND and OR situations collectively.
- For example, if a choice statement accommodates two situations, every of which could be true or false, there are four possible condition outcomes.
Unlike a triggerA set off is a set of values or conditions of a platform that are defined to cause an automation to run. [Learn more], which is always or, conditions are and by default – all conditions have to be true. If the software being tested has a lot of complex features then, the test situations are extra comprehensive and designed at a low-level to extend the test protection. A test case is an in depth doc that includes particular inputs, execution circumstances, and anticipated results for a specific test. A check scenario, on the opposite hand, is a high-level description of what to check, typically focusing on a specific performance or feature of the software.
This research was carried out through a coordinated research project (CRP) with members from 17 Member States. This group of specialists compiled the current information in a report together with areas of future research and development to cover growing older mechanisms and means to identify and manage the consequences of aging. They established a benchmarking programme using cable samples aged underneath thermal and/or radiation conditions, and examined before and after ageing by various strategies and organizations. The results of those benchmark tests were then compared to establish the best condition monitoring strategies and set up recommendations for improvements. The conclusions of the information analysis offered insight into condition monitoring strategies which yield usable or traceable outcomes. When testing software, you can’t confirm all possible situations, so it’s impossible to seek out all errors.
Here, you simply want to check if a given methodology works for a quantity of components inside an equivalence class. This alleviates us of getting to test all components within a set. Low-level cases are used in automated checks, the place actions are one hundred pc repeatable.
Conditions can be utilized inside a scriptScripts are parts that enable users to specify a sequence of actions to be executed by Home Assistant when turned on. [Learn more] or automationAutomations in Home Assistant allow you to automatically respond to things that occur in and round your house. When a condition evaluates true, the script or automation shall be executed.
A Test Scenario is a probable means or technique to check an Application. It is outlined as a real-life performance that may be tested for an application beneath take a look at. A test state of affairs places a tester in the long run user’s place to determine out real-world situations and use instances of the Application underneath check.
Before creating test cases, you should think about the tools to be used. There are multiple apps in the marketplace for streamlining the testing process, e.g. Cases and scenarios organised in tables are clear and simply accessible. Boundary values are values located on the “border” of an equivalence class.
Alternatively, the situation can test towards a state attribute.The condition will move if the attribute matches the given state. In the next instance,both media gamers need to be either paused or taking part in for the condition to cross. Test multiple AND and OR situations in a single condition statement.
These instruments are automated tools that decrease the time and effort of a tester as in comparison with the normal method. The Test Scenario offers a high-level overview of what must be examined.In liner statements, a take a look at state of affairs is an entire list containing test casesthat cover the end-to-end performance of a software program. The take a look at state of affairs is a categorization oftestable requirements at a high level.
In abstract, check circumstances are essential components of software testing that help outline what aspects of the software need to be examined, under what circumstances, and with what anticipated outcomes. They contribute to the general effectiveness and thoroughness of the testing course of. In this instance, every condition is tested with both true and false outcomes, guaranteeing one hundred pc situation coverage. It can also be attainable to check the situation towards a quantity of entities directly.The condition will move if all entities are in the specified zone. Testing if an entity is matching a set of potential conditions;The condition will move if the entity matches one of many states given.
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!